Understanding the Benefits of High Frequency Welded Fin Tubes in Heat Exchanger Technology

Fin tubes, typically referred to as finned tubes, are heat exchanger elements designed to enhance thermal performance by enhancing the heat transfer surface location. The concept behind finned tubes is fairly easy: by affixing fins-- metal projections-- along the size of a tube, the surface area readily available for warm exchange is substantially increased.

High frequency welded fin tubes stand for a significant innovation in fin tube innovation. These tubes are made using high-frequency welding procedures, permitting for precision in the bonding of fins to the tube body. The high-frequency welding strategy not only improves the integrity of the bond however additionally reduces the heat-affected zone, decreasing the potential for material deterioration. With these features, high frequency welded finned tubes are significantly preferred for applications requiring reliability and effectiveness. The difference between seamless and welded pipes is crucial when considering application requirements. While seamless pipes provide the advantage of continual product without joints, welded pipes can give even more economical remedies for sure applications. Understanding the subtleties of seamless pipe versus welded pipe is necessary for engineers and acquiring agents who intend to balance efficiency with cost factors to consider.

The differentiation between seamless and welded pipes typically brings about conversations concerning viability for different pressures and temperatures. While seamless pipes frequently dominate high-pressure applications because of their uniform material quality and strength, welded pipes find their area in applications where product expense and availability are crucial elements. This difference is important for engineers when choosing the finest services for transport systems, specifically in extreme atmospheres subjected to varying thermal and mechanical loads.
